Supreme Court Limits Health Plan’s Right to Recovery Under Subrogation Clause

The Supreme Court recently held that ERISA health plans cannot recover amounts paid on behalf of an injured participant who later receives settlement
proceeds from third parties if the participant has spent the proceeds on non-traceable items (for example, on services or consumable items).

The Fight to Kill the Cadillac Tax

There aren’t many issues upon which Republicans and Democrats can enthusiastically agree. But many folks on both sides of the aisle are united in their
opposition to the so-called Cadillac Tax. The nickname “Cadillac Tax” implies that the tax will apply to only the richest health plans, but this is not the case.
Based on employers’ current plans, experts predict that about 60% of employers would face the tax by 2022.
